FANUC ROBODRILLエラーコード

このQ&Aのポイント
  • FANUC ROBODRILLのマシニング中に発生した「IO1030 プログラムメモリ チェックサムエラー」というエラーコードについて困っています。
  • マニュアルを確認しても解決策が書かれておらず、どう対応すれば良いのかわかりません。
  • 加工プログラム自体は正常に動作しているため、エラーの原因がわかりません。解決策を教えてください。
回答を見る
  • ベストアンサー

FANUC ROBODRILLエラーコード

FANUC ROBODRILL 制御機 31i-A5 のマシニングについて 昨日、あるプラグラムを加工中つぎのエラーコードで マシニングが止まっていました。 「IO1030 プログラムメモリ チェックサムエラー」 たまに出るエラーで、マニュアルを見てもどうしていいか 書いておらず困っております。 加工プログラムは何度も動いているものなので 間違いはないです。 どのように対応すればエラーが、でなくなるか アドバイスをお願いします。

noname#230358
noname#230358

質問者が選んだベストアンサー

  • ベストアンサー
noname#230359
noname#230359
回答No.2

コンピュータ用語の「プログラムメモリ チェックサムエラー」は放置出来ない。 コンピュータのメモリの単位は 1ビット×8=1バイト  (2~4バイトをワードと称し、それ単位の場合有) メモリー、特に動作プログラム格納部に誤りを生じると暴走する。それを防ぐというよか間違った時に即停止させるのがチエックサム。 前記1バイトに余分に1ビット追加(=9ビット)して、それを全体で常に奇数または偶数になるようにしておき、状態を監視している。 その監視役が警告を発した! そうなるのは電圧低下、つまりはバックアップ電池の低下の可能性が高い。また雷などでの瞬間停電でも起きる。 これらで問題がなく頻発するのなら機器不良。回答(1)に同じ。

noname#230358
質問者

お礼

アドバイスありがとうございます。 そういえば少し前に、バッテリーのエラーメッセージが出ていました。 さっそく電池をかえてみます。 ありがとうございました。

その他の回答 (1)

noname#230359
noname#230359
回答No.1

ファナックに問い合わせるのが一番早いと思います。

関連するQ&A

  • NCのMコード

    マシニングセンターにエアーシリンダーを追加して Mコードで制御したいです。 他社のマシニングを見ると改造していて(だれが改造したかは不明です。)Mコードで制御しています。 FANUCのMコード表をみても書かれていないのですが、ものにより使用できないのでしょうか?  滝沢鉄工製 TDC-10  (FANUC : F21-MB)

  • FANUC GOTO使えない

    HOWA製マシニングセンター(FANUC 16i-MB)でGOTOを使いプログラムをスキップしようとしましたが、マクロが使えない為か、004 ブロックの先頭にアドレスがありませんのアラームが出ます。 GOTOの代用で何か使えるものがあれば教えてもらいたいです。

  • fanuc 11mについて

    先日fanuc OSの「イレブン」とは何かと質問したものです。 先方に機械が搬入されたところ、回答者様の言われた11mでした。 しかし中古機でしたので、fanucマニュアルがなく設定などが分かりません。 そこで質問なのですが… 下記該当のパラメータ番号分かる方、ご教授ください。 (1)パラメータ書き込み可不可パラメータ (2)表示言語パラメータ(英語から日本語にしたいです) (3)O9000番台プログラム編集可不可パラメータ よろしくお願いいたします。

  • プログラム番号と変数のみ送信して運用する方法に

    FANUC 0i-TBで制御されるNC機へPCからプログラムを送信(RS232C)して運用しています。 毎回プログラムを全文送信するのではなく、プログラム番号と変数のみ送信して加工できれば通信時間が短縮できます。 方法が分かる方、是非教えてください。

  • 複数の木工用NC機(FANUC)へのパソコンか…

    複数の木工用NC機(FANUC)へのパソコンからのNCプログラム同時転送 建具メーカー(下請け)のデータ管理部門に所属しております。 転職前に他社で数年間、マシングセンターや木工NCルーターのプログラム作成及び現場での加工・オペレーション等の経験があります。 現在は事務所内でFA・OAの双方のデータ管理等を任されております。 質問ですが、工場長より、『パソコンから複数の木工用NC機(制御装置はFANUC)へのNCプログラムの同時転送ができないものか?』といった相談を受けて悩んでおります。 木工用NCとはいっても、FANUC制御装置なので、RS-232Cケーブルで1:1の転送は行っております。段取り時間を短縮する為だと田と思いますが、NC用プログラム転送 を同時に行いたいようです。 どうか、みなさんの知恵を貸して下さい。 なやんでおりますの数年間しょ木工複数の木工用NC機(FANUC)へのパソコンからのNCプログラム同時転送

  • アプローチ痕をなくしたい

    FFCAMを使ってNCプログラムを作成しています。コーナー部の取り残し加工等で工具の進入、退避が多いパスになりますと加工したワークにアプローチ痕が残ってしまいます。0.02程度食い込んでそうです。どうにか改善する方法はありませんでしょうか。ちなみに機械はFANUCのROBODRILL-T21iDsを使っています。

    • 締切済み
    • CAM
  • CAD/CAMについて

    はじめて投稿します。宜しくお願いします。 私は、CAMTUSのたまごWinを使って樹脂の部品加工(NC旋盤、マシニングで)を行なっているのですが、3次元加工のできるCAD/CAMソフトの購入を検討中です。同じCAMTUSの Speedy mill 3D も考え中なのですが、他社にも、低コストで使いやすいCAD/CAMはあるのでしょうか? あれば教えていただけないでしょうか?使用しているマシニングはFANUC ROBODRILL α-21iEです。ちなみに保守契約料金?サポート料金?などは、どこの会社で購入しても別途必要となるのでしょうか?

  • C# ファイル削除のエラーコード

    言語:C# の質問です。(初心者 初めて1週間)  ファイルの削除を行った際に、別プロセスが使用中で、 削除できなかった場合に対して、別処理を行いたいです。  ファイルが削除できない場合は、エラーを取得することができるのですが、  別プロセスが使用中のみの制御を入れたいと思っています。  VB6では、ファイル削除(Kill)ができなかった場合に、 エラーコードを返して、該当するエラーコードのみに 別処理を行うことができていました。  それと同じことを、C#でも行いたいです。 処理としては、 1.ファイルの削除を行う 2.ファイルの削除が出来なかった場合に対してのみ、  別処理を入れる  (別プロセスが使用中のため削除できないファイルに対して)  このような処理を行いたいのですが、 ファイルが削除できなかった場合の、エラーコードを 求め方を色々調べてみたのですが、見つかりません。 下記ソースで、プログラムを作成中です。 try{    System.IO.File.Delete(@削除するファイル名); } cach(System.IO.IOException) {   //ここでエラーコードを取得し、該当するエラーコードのみに   //対して、別処理を入れたい   MessageBox.Show(err.Message); }   MessageBox.Show(err.Message);   ↑   もし、エラーコードが取得できないのであれば、  このエラーメッセージ文章に対してリテラルで制御をいれる  ことも考えています。 どうか、ご教授ください。 よろしくお願いいたします。

  • FANUC MコードのPMCへの取込みについて

    FANUC 32i-Bを搭載したマシニングセンタを会社で使用しております。 新たにSOLバルブ、Mコードを追加して加工サイクル終盤に切粉を流すクーラント吐出をさせようとしています。 設備メーカーが用意しているMコードで間にM88、M89と連続で空いている所があり、そこをバルブのON、OFFに使用しようとしています。 PMCラダー上には常時OFFになっているM88、M89と紐付けされている接点、FINのコイルもあり恐らくその回路を流用すればやりたい事は出来ると思うのですが、疑問があるのでご教示願います。 結合説明書にてF10がM機能M0〜M31 └F13までで32点は理解しました。 F14が第2M機能 M200番台 F16が第3M機能 M200番台 となっておりM32からはどの様にしてPMCに取り込んでいるのかがわかりません。 デコード指令は DECB 502 F10 0 E100です。 素人で申し訳ないのですが ①M32以降をどのようにPMCに取り込んでいるのか教えて頂きたい。 ②デコード指令も説明書ではよくわからない為教えて頂きたいです。 ③第2M機能、第3 M機能とはなにか教えて頂きたい。 質問が多すぎて申し訳ないのですがご教示頂けますと幸いです。 よろしくお願い致します。

  • FANUCロボドリルのプログラムについて

    初めて質問させて頂きますが長文お許しください。 私の会社でロボドリルを使用していますが、 CAMが無いのでプログラムをクイックエディタから手入力しているのですが、 先日間違えてザグリ穴や精度穴を加工するマクロプログラムを削除してしまい 困っています。 FANUCに問い合わせたのですが以前は丁寧に教えてもらえてたのですが何年ぶりかに電話したら、今は提案?的な感じで正確な事は言えないと断られてしまいました。 私はロボドリルを使い始めて7年程たちますが、 FANUCのスクールへ行った訳でもなく独学(ネット等)&以前は教えてくれたFANUCからのプログラムを書き換えながら使ってきただけなので知識としては素人レベルです。 因みにFANUCから提案?されたのは円弧補間?みたいな事を言われたのですがさっぱりわからずでして・・・ 間違えて消してしまったマクロプログラムは 穴の中心をX0Y0とし冒頭のGコード省略として、 まず穴中心座標に移動(X0Y0) Z5→Z0と2段階で刃先を移動 加工開始座標に移動(X0Y0) #100・・・←・・・は#100の後に何かあったと思うのですが思い出せませんが繰り返し動作をする時用の記号?数値?だと教えられました。 Z-10(穴深さ50として) 〇〇〇〇←覚えてません・・・10←使用工具径 〇〇〇〇←覚えてません・・・90←下穴径 〇〇〇〇←覚えてません・・・100仕上げ径(φ100として) 〇〇〇〇←覚えてません・・・2 ←切り込み量 〇〇〇〇←覚えてません・・・500 ←送り 〇〇〇〇←覚えてません・・・400 ←仕上げ送り (こんな感じで数値を図面に合わせてその都度変えて使っていました。) ~~~~~~~~~~~~~~~~~~~~~~~~~ ここから↓は 〇〇〇〇←覚えてませんがここから何十行と#とか数値とか[ ]な記号?が組み合わさって続いてました。 最後にLT〇〇←深さ50としてLT5 こんな感じで座標や数値を変えてたけで〇〇〇〇部がいっさい覚えていませんが どなたか解りますでしょうか? 宜しくお願い致します。 長文失礼いたしました。